as a studyblr with high grades I feel the need to put it out there, Iāve never pulled an all-nighter. Yes Iāve stayed up late in an effort to get assessment done but never past 11:30pm. I can count on two hands the times Iāve sacrificed my sleep and long term health for school. As a studyblr with sleep apnea and anxiety, to me it is not worth pulling all-nighters. Instead use your time effectively. Start assignments straight away and aim to have them finished two days before the due date and just going over and editing until itās due. The key to never having to sacrifice sleep is good planning and following through. Maybe itās that you should stay at school for an extra hour or two to get work done, or maybe itās that you need to wake up super early to work before school. Whatever it is, figure it out and carry through. Please donāt glorify bad sleeping habits, it hurts you more than you could know.
edit: I understand how not everybody can live this way and that sometimes mental/physical health leaves people unable to work during the day and have to sacrifice sleep in order to get stuff done. I have seen and experienced this and I know how hard it can be. My love and support is with you, you can get through this.

Stop glorifying unhealthy study habits
Because not enough are talking about this
A lot of people (not just langblr, studyblr too )have been glamorizing the way Asians study in certain countries as depicted on tv, news , various media sources. Saying oh they are working so hard for their goal and look how dedicated they are. Please stop. Seriously. My degree is in psychology and I focus on mental health. Iāve done research in Korea and continue to take psychology classes in korean about various issues (Iāve taken cultural psych, neuro psych 1&2, psych of happiness and Iām currently taking psychology of addiction). Iāve also extensively talked to high schoolers in Korea about this ādedicated studyā and most of them said they were stressed to the point of having physical symptoms of being stressed out, almost half were depressed or showed symptoms of anxiety and I wonāt even get into things like suicidal thoughts, actual suicide, self harm, eating disorders that are also happening in correlation to study related stress manifesting itself in other ways. This isnāt just Korea. Iāve read research (just not as extensive about the same happening in other Asian countries and even some western now and days) Why the heck are yāall out here trying to glorify something that is clearly unhealthy and causing other people harm? And then promoting it to your followers as something to āmotivate themā ?
Getting into your dream school/ uni, becoming fluent in 2 month in a language, whatever is not worth it if you end up hating life, physically unhealthy or mentally ill as a result of it
